Smartphone Gimbal Market Outlook (2025 to 2035)
The global Smartphone Gimbal Market is forecast to reach USD 882 million by 2035, registering a CAGR of 4.9% between 2025 and 2035. The industry was valued at USD 524 million in 2024 and is likely to add USD 350 million in the span of the next ten years.
The smartphone gimbal market is driven by over USD 150 billion content creation economy, as the new and booming industry necessitates high-quality, stabilized video content amid advancements in mobile imaging. Growing adoption across industries, as well as immersive media like VR/AR, further accelerates demand for intuitive stabilization tools.

What are the challenges and restraining factors of the smartphone gimbal market?
Despite strong growth prospects, the smartphone gimbal market faces several structural and operational challenges. One of the primary constraints is the diminishing perceived value of external stabilization tools in light of ongoing advancements in internal smartphone stabilization technology. The pivotal question in the minds of many consumer point to the need of an additional gimbal in light of the fact that smartphones are equipped with built-in digital and optical stabilization, especially in the newer phone models.
Costs are also an issue of concern, especially in the price-conscious markets. Top-tier gimbals almost always use high-quality parts and have superior functionality that substantially increases its price. The cost of investment in the price-performance ratio might be prohibitive to most consumers, especially casual users, which would inhibit mass adaptation among mainstream users beyond enthusiast and professional user bases.
Another obstacle is the learning curve of using gimbal. The optimum utilization of a gimbal includes learning balance mechanics, motor calibration and software interfaces. This does not appeal to novices particularly people who are not conversant with generating video tools. Consequently, the product has a tendency to be viewed as niche or too technical.
Furthermore, markets can be fragmented in a way that creates a less-than-optimal user experience due to the incompatibility of designs and software across devices. The fluctuation of smartphone size, weight, and user interfaces makes it really difficult to attain seamless integration and this may cause mechanical misalignment or software incompatibility.
Another source of risk is the volatility in the supply chain, particularly for more precise parts such as brushless motors and motion sensors, among others. The delay in logistics and increase in raw material prices may affect the production schedules and retail prices finally impacting the market stability.

Three-Axis Stabilization Boosts Precision for Mobile Filmmaking
Three-axis gimbals continue to lead the market due to their ability to deliver high-precision stabilization across tilt, pan, and roll movements. These systems provide the level of control required for professional-grade video, particularly in dynamic shooting conditions. As the real-time tracking, motor response speed, and calibration accuracy acquire further developments, users will be able to obtain the smoother, more cinematic results without performing a significant amount of post-editing.
It supports automated capabilities such as subject following and motion time-lapse in integration with mobile applications enabling more creative opportunities. With the higher resolution and frame rate in the smartphone camera there is a parallel growth in the requirement of stabilizers to keep pace with it. Technology is also applicable in this segment through the use of technologies that help in the saving of power, as well as control of heat. Three-axis gimbals are the most popular among customers who value the quality of video and want to use equipment that could be applicable in complicated filming conditions.

Recent Development
- In February 2025, DJI unveiled the Osmo Mobile 7 Series, featuring advanced three-axis stabilization and ActiveTrack 7.0 technology. The flagship Osmo Mobile 7P includes a Multifunctional Module offering gesture controls, integrated lighting, and audio enhancements, enabling professional-quality smartphone videography with ease.
- In January 2025, Insta360 introduced the Flow 2 Pro, a smartphone gimbal featuring Deep Track 4.0 AI for multi-subject tracking and Pro Framing Grid for creative composition. It supports Apple's DockKit, enabling seamless use with native and third-party iOS camera apps. Enhanced tripod legs and Apple Watch remote control offer improved hands-free operation.
